Q&A: Do modern canon rebel lenses work with 35mm cameras?
Question by : Do modern canon rebel lenses work with 35mm cameras?
I have one canon EOS rebel XS (digital; dslr). Since I am very into photography, a friend of mine offered me his 35mm film canon rebel (EOS rebel 2000 slr). Will the lenses for the digital version work with the film version? Or do I have to buy new lenses?
Best answer:
Answer by Judas
Any Canon camera with EOS in its name will take the same EF mount lenses.
However, there is a wrinkle. Lots of the DSLRs came with lenses with a special EF-S mount. These protrude into the camera body and so will only work with the smaller mirrors in a DSLR.
You might not be able to use all of your DSLR’s lenses with the Rebel 2000, but you will be able to use the 2000′s lenses with your XS.
In summary:
EF works with all EOS cameras
EF-S only works with crop-sensor DSLRs.
